Traveling from the Okanagan Valley in British Columbia, home to a burgeoning wine industry and over 100 wineries, can arm one with some inherrent knowledge of wine and the business. Thus, arriving in the Temecula Valley, home to Southern California Wine Country, we were prepared to judge with a somewhat critical eye.

Alas, this is a region that must wind up on your list of vacation destinations. With nearly 40 wineries, seven golf courses and the historic city of Temecula celebrating its 150th anniversary, the region allows you to leave the hustle and bustle of urban life behind.

After a day on the links at the spiffy Temecula Creek Inn, we stopped by the Callaway Winery and Robert Renzoni Vineyards for some wine tasting and chat with the locals.
